In the afternoon we will take the excursion to the Brazilian Falls. Departure from the hotel to the Foz do Iguazú National Park. The Iguaçu National Park, in Brazil, was declared a World Natural Heritage Site by UNESCO in 1986, two years after the naming of the Iguazú National Park, in Argentina.

The visiting area consists of a single circuit of walkways that faces the falls, offering a truly impressive panoramic view. The circuit measures 1,200 meters with steps that make it impossible for wheelchairs to get around.

A unique tour through our city, forests, lakes, and mountains, following the shore of Lake Nahuel Huapi along Avenida Bustillo. The beauty of the landscape is present throughout the journey. Various points along the way, including natural viewpoints like Bahía López and Punto Panorámico, are perfect for taking in this natural wonder.

After passing Playa Bonita, we arrive at the base of Cerro Campanario. Here, we can ascend to the summit at 1,050 meters. At the top, there is a panoramic café with a capacity for 80 people, featuring two terraces and a 20-meter-high structure.

The Cerro Campanario chairlift, located in the “center of the landscape,” lifts visitors to the “perfect height for awe,” offering the most breathtaking views of the area.

The tour begins in the morning, departing from the city of El Calafate. After a journey of 80 km we arrive at the viewpoint area, with walkways and balconies facing the Perito Moreno Glacier. The walkways have viewpoint balconies on different levels, which allow varying perspectives of the impressive glacier and landscape. The viewpoints are connected by ramps and stairways which can be walked during the excursion.

The excursion is complemented with a short navigation of 1 hour. This excursion allows for an up-close view of the glacier. The boat navigates within 150 meters of the glacier.

We will head towards Tierra del Fuego National Park, which is located 12 km from the center of the city of Ushuaia.
Before entering the National Park, we will stop at the End of the World Train station (optional) where passengers who wish to can choose to take the mythical train ride (about 60 minutes) that ends inside the National Park.
Those who do not take the train ride can enjoy a short walk in the Tierra del Fuego forest.

Once the train ride is over, the group will meet again inside the Park with the vehicle and guide to continue the tour to Ensenada, a bay that combines the Andes, the sub-Antarctic forest and the sea in one place.
